Lines Matching refs:sapi_header

121 SAPI_API void sapi_free_header(sapi_header_struct *sapi_header)  in sapi_free_header()  argument
123 efree(sapi_header->header); in sapi_free_header()
646 static void sapi_header_add_op(sapi_header_op_enum op, sapi_header_struct *sapi_header TSRMLS_DC) in sapi_header_add_op()
649 (SAPI_HEADER_ADD & sapi_module.header_handler(sapi_header, op, &SG(sapi_headers) TSRMLS_CC))) { in sapi_header_add_op()
651 char *colon_offset = strchr(sapi_header->header, ':'); in sapi_header_add_op()
657 … sapi_remove_header(&SG(sapi_headers).headers, sapi_header->header, strlen(sapi_header->header)); in sapi_header_add_op()
661 zend_llist_add_element(&SG(sapi_headers).headers, (void *) sapi_header); in sapi_header_add_op()
663 sapi_free_header(sapi_header); in sapi_header_add_op()
669 sapi_header_struct sapi_header; in sapi_header_op() local
709 sapi_module.header_handler(&sapi_header, op, &SG(sapi_headers) TSRMLS_CC); in sapi_header_op()
735 sapi_header.header = header_line; in sapi_header_op()
736 sapi_header.header_len = header_line_len; in sapi_header_op()
737 sapi_module.header_handler(&sapi_header, op, &SG(sapi_headers) TSRMLS_CC); in sapi_header_op()
761 sapi_header.header = header_line; in sapi_header_op()
762 sapi_header.header_len = header_line_len; in sapi_header_op()
803 sapi_header.header = newheader; in sapi_header_op()
804 sapi_header.header_len = newlen - 1; in sapi_header_op()
836 if (sapi_header.header==header_line) { in sapi_header_op()
844 sapi_header_add_op(op, &sapi_header TSRMLS_CC); in sapi_header_op()